I almost always check Reddit for reviews for products because it's such a huge and diverse site. And they hate scammers as much as the next guy and will out them. Google is your friend too, individual site's search functions can suck. Here's how to get it to search a specific website for a query. Bold always remains the same, italics are specific to your search.

site:website.com keyword(s)

Or in this case:

site:reddit.com luxe scam
